openfire服务器是什么

fiy 其他 84

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Openfire服务器是一种基于Java的即时通讯(IM)服务器软件。它是一个开源的、实时的、可扩展的聊天和协作平台,使用XMPP(可扩展消息和存在协议)作为通讯协议。Openfire服务器可以提供企业内部或团队之间的即时消息传递服务,使用户可以通过文本、语音、视频等方式进行实时沟通。

    Openfire服务器具有以下特点和功能:

    1. 简单易用:Openfire服务器安装和配置简单,通过Web界面进行管理和设置,使管理员可以轻松地创建和管理用户、群组和聊天室。
    2. 可扩展:Openfire服务器支持插件机制,可以通过添加插件来增强服务器功能,如支持文件传输、离线消息等。
    3. 安全可靠:Openfire服务器支持TLS/SSL加密传输,确保消息的安全性和隐私。同时,它还具有用户认证和授权功能,可确保只有授权用户可以访问服务器。
    4. 跨平台支持:Openfire服务器可以在多个操作系统上运行,如Windows、Linux等,支持多种数据库,如MySQL、Oracle等。
    5. 可定制性强:Openfire服务器是开源软件,提供源代码,可以根据需求进行定制开发,扩展和适应各种应用场景。

    总之,Openfire服务器是一款强大、灵活、易用的即时通讯服务器软件,可以满足企业、组织或团队内部的实时沟通和协作需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Openfire服务器是一种开源的即时通讯服务器软件,它基于XMPP(可扩展消息和存在协议)协议。它可以作为企业内部的即时通讯工具,用于实时的消息传递和协作。

    Openfire服务器具有以下特点:

    1. 开源:Openfire是开源软件,使用Apache许可证,因此用户可以自由地修改和定制源代码,满足特定的需求。

    2. 跨平台:Openfire服务器可以运行在多种操作系统上,包括Windows、Linux和Mac OS X等,因此可以灵活地部署在不同的环境中。

    3. 可扩展:Openfire服务器提供了丰富的插件和扩展机制,用户可以根据自己的需求来选择和定制功能。例如,用户可以添加群组管理、文件传输、语音视频通话等功能。

    4. 安全性:Openfire服务器支持加密通信,可以使用SSL/TLS协议来保护数据的传输安全。同时,它也支持基于用户名和密码的用户认证,以确保只有授权用户才能访问服务器。

    5. 可靠性:Openfire服务器具有良好的稳定性和可靠性,支持集群部署,可以通过添加多个服务器来实现负载均衡和故障恢复。

    总之,Openfire服务器是一种功能强大、灵活可定制的即时通讯服务器软件,可以满足企业内部消息传递和协作的需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Openfire服务器是一款基于XMPP协议的实时通信服务器。Openfire原名为Wildfire,是一个开源的、跨平台的聊天服务器,采用Java语言编写,支持Windows、Linux和Mac OS等操作系统。

    Openfire服务器的主要功能是提供安全稳定的即时通信服务,可以用于组织内部的企业协作、团队沟通、实时聊天等场景。通过Openfire服务器,用户可以创建群组、发送消息、在线状态管理等。

    Openfire服务器的架构基于XMPP协议(可扩展通讯和预备协议),它是一种基于XML的开放性即时通信协议。XMPP协议支持多用户、跨平台、XML格式的消息传递,以及在线状态管理、订阅/发布机制等功能,提供了丰富的特性和扩展性,并且可以与其他IM系统互通。

    为了部署和使用Openfire服务器,需要按照以下步骤进行操作:

    1. 下载和安装Openfire服务器:访问Openfire官方网站,选择适合自己操作系统的版本,下载并安装Openfire服务器。

    2. 配置Openfire服务器:运行安装程序后,按照向导进行配置,设置管理员账号和密码,选择数据库类型(默认使用内置的HSQLDB数据库,也可以选择其他数据库如MySQL等),设置域名等。

    3. 启动和管理Openfire服务器:安装完成后,运行Openfire服务器,可以通过Web管理界面(默认端口为9090)进行管理。在管理界面上,可以配置用户、群组、身份验证、消息策略等。

    4. 创建用户和配置:通过管理界面,可以创建用户和群组。可以为用户设置昵称、头像等个人信息,并设置用户的好友关系、订阅/发布机制等。

    5. 配置客户端和连接:在使用Openfire服务器之前,需要选择和配置适合的客户端软件。常见的客户端软件包括Spark、Pidgin、Adium等,通过这些软件,可以连接Openfire服务器,并进行通信。

    6. 安全设置和扩展:Openfire服务器支持SSL加密传输,可以通过配置启用SSL。另外,Openfire服务器还支持插件扩展,可以根据需要安装和配置插件,以增加功能和定制化。

    总结:
    Openfire服务器是一款基于XMPP协议的实时通信服务器,提供安全稳定的即时通信服务。通过配置和管理Openfire服务器,可以创建用户、群组,发送消息,管理在线状态等。需要选择合适的客户端软件进行连接和通信。操作流程包括下载和安装Openfire,配置服务器和用户,启动和管理服务器,配置客户端和连接,进行安全设置和扩展等步骤。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部